Papillon is the French word for butterfly. It is also the title of a 1973 film starring the late Steve McQueen and Dustin Hoffman, who portray convicts sentenced to the penal colony at French Guiana. The film is instructive in that it demonstrates an alternative use for a bison tube.
The cache is a small, round plastic container with a log, pencil, some papillons and a bison tube for FTF, in case you're sent to a penal colony. This is a cache and dash, because parking is a few yards away.
